CDC’s new IFR survivability estimates after contracting the virus are broken down by age as part of the agency’s “COVID-19 Pandemic Planning Scenarios" Scenario 5: Current Best Estimate are as follows:
0-19 years old survivability rate is 99.997% (1 in 33,000)
20-49 years old survivability rate is 99.98% (1 in 5,000)
50-69 years old survivability rate is 99.5%
70 years old or older survivability rate is 94.6%
To put that in a different perspective the CDC’s new estimate for the death rate after contracting COVID-19 by age are:
0-19 years old death rate is .003% or .00003
20-49 years old death rate is .02% or .0002
50-69 years old death rate is .5%% or .005
70 years old or older death rate is 5.4% or .054
